Giraffes are one of the most photogenic animals in the bush and always a great sighting while on safari. These guys were having some trouble accepting each other and came into a typical giraffe ‘standoff’ which eventually ended up in a battle which is called ‘necking’. It is a phenomenon where the giraffes swing their necks to hurt the other individual in order to become the dominant one.
